Force-feeding Denounced in JAMA

A commentary in the most recent Journal of the American Medical Association has denounced the practice of force-feeding, which Guantánamo's medical authorities have used in a clearly punitive way in medically non-essential situations.

The statement urges military physicians to refuse to participate in the awful process, rather than violate their medical ethics by forcing a treatment upon an unwilling "patient."
